As a Registered Mental Health Nurse (RMN) or Learning Disabilities Nurse (RNLD) you will provide high-quality evidence-based support to women over the age of 18 who have complex emotional and mental health problems associated with significant risk behaviours.Typically, they have a diagnosis of personality disorder or a severe mental illness.
They may not have had their needs met in a general psychiatric service including acute inpatient units, community mental health teams or community personality disorder service. The service focuses on active rehabilitation with a view to achieving a sustainabledischarge.
